Abstract
A continuously variable transmission has a drive shaft, a power takeoff shaft and a power branching device disposed therebetween and has a continuously variable power branch containing a variator, and a mechanical power branch parallel thereto. To provide a large adjustment range and a high level of efficiency in conjunction with a simple and space-saving configuration, the variator is an electromagnetic transmission with a rotatably mounted drive rotor connected to an input shaft, a rotatably mounted power takeoff rotor connected to an output shaft, and a stator connected fixed in terms of rotation and mounted axially displaceably. The rotors have permanent magnets which are each distributed circumferentially axially adjacent to one another and have alternating polarity. The stator has at least one short-circuit winding disposed radially adjacent to the permanent magnets and the effective transmission ratio being adjustable by axial displacement of the stator relative to the rotors.
